Official London Marathon Statement: Suspension of Abraham Kiptum

Abraham Kiptum (Kenya), world half marathon record holder, has been suspended from competition by the Athletics Integrity Unit following an Athlete Biological Passport (ABP) violation. He will not take part in Sunday’s Virgin Money London Marathon and has left London.

Hugh Brasher, Event Director for the Virgin Money London Marathon, said: “We have a zero-tolerance policy on doping. London is part of the Abbott World Marathon Majors and we recently announced a groundbreaking extensive intelligence-driven testing programme. This shows the programme is working. Cheats will be caught and there is no place for them in marathon running.”
